Syntronic had the honor of hosting the Ambassador of Indonesia, Kamapradipta Isnomo, at its headquarters in Gävle today. The visit provided an opportunity for valuable discussions on technological advancements and potential areas for cooperation.

After 15 years in Indonesia, Syntronic has established a strong presence in the country, becoming a reliable player in the tech sector with a special focus on the aftermarket segment. The company’s Jakarta-based aftermarket center has a Bonded Zone Licence that empowers the site to handle global repair volumes. Across its global operations, including Indonesia, Syntronic remains dedicated to contributing to sustainable development through job creation and innovative business operations.

"We were pleased to welcome the ambassador to discuss how we can strenghten our cooperation to drive technological progress and contribibute to sustainable development,” says Björn Jansson, Founder and CEO of Syntronic Group.

The ambassador had previously visited Syntronic’s office in Kista Science City in Stockholm, which is the world’s largest ICT cluster after Silicon Valley in California. This visit marked his second time at Syntronic’s headquarters in Sweden, where he once again had the opportunity to experience one of northern Europe’s most advanced technological labs. In previous meetings, the company also had the privilege of hosting representatives from the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Indonesia at its research and development facilities in Gävle.

Sustainability initiatives

Over the years, Syntronic has fostered a strong relationship with Indonesia through various engagements. Recently, the company participated in the Invest in Indonesia Forum, hosted by the Indonesian Embassy at the World Trade Center in Stockholm. During the forum, Syntronic was highlighted by Business Sweden as a positive example of an engineering company that has a strong and reliable presence in Indonesia. Additionally, Syntronic’s commitment to Indonesia is reflected in its active role in national initiatives, such as its participation in the Sweden-Indonesia Sustainability Partnership Week.

Looking ahead, Syntronic will continue its engagement with Indonesia and exploring strengthened opportunities for cooperation.

About us

Syntronic develops tomorrow's technology in the telecommunication, automotive, manufacturing, and medtech sectors. The global company specializes in advanced product and system development, manufacturing, and aftermarket services.

Syntronic offers comprehensive solutions covering the entire product lifecycle, from research and development to the NPI, production and aftermarket stages. Among Syntronic's partners are some of the world's most technology-intensive companies and organizations.
